I have a 'hot wallet' to move stuff and bitcoin-qt or litecoin-qt on my laptop to move crypto around

for cold wallet storage...(stuff I want keep safe long term) I have 'virgin' paper wallets ..who have never touched the internet Smiley

The main ones in a 'safety deposit box' at the bank Smiley

thus I dump stuff to hold long term to them (in plastic in a safety deposit box) ..that means ONLY funds can go in not out....

the hot wallets move the stuff back and forth

a paper wallet will get made to move significant amounts 1x to either the hot wallet or the cold storage wallets for payments etc

I always clean my hot wallets out to a fresh virgin wallet if it gets in the 100's of $$ to be safe

I never leave ANY crypto on my laptop or on www.coinbase.com or any other exchange

I might have 200 to 300 usd on a blockchain wallet for a quick buy of something (but realize this is not safe) but that is about it

in other words, I use paper wallets to move funds accordingly to not keep any crypto on my laptop wallet nor in a hot wallet I can't afford

in that I REALLY REALLY try to HOARD BTC and LTC....and/or get ASIC equipment...my needs are modest and I only have to look at any of this

moving about in paper wallet action maybe once every 4-6 weeks..the mining dumps into a virgin paper wallet for eventual use with the above

odd perhaps...but works for me .and more importantly if it hits the 'cold paper wallets' 'Virgin' never touched the inet' in the safety deposit box

well....that stops me from spending too much ..it goes there ..it stays there (mainly because it keeps me honest and a pain in the ass to go

and move etc.....guilt of saving via the use of paper wallets and safety deposit boxes ...saves me much crypto 'bored' in the middle of the nite Smiley

anyway what I do...but again...my needs are modest and mostly hoard ..either for ASIC equip or into the cold storage wallet so this is NOT

too inconvenient for me Smiley
